(KABC) -- More than 3,000 pounds of methamphetamine and 66 kilograms of cocaine were found in a massive drug bust in Norco last month, making it the largest seizure of meth for the Drug Enforcement Administration's Los Angeles Division. On Oct. 9, U.S. Customs and Border Protection stopped a truck crossing from Mexico into the United States at San Diego's Otay Mesa and found 3,014 pounds (1,367.1 kilograms) of methamphetamine, the agency said Sunday. In what was described as the largest narcotics haul ever, federal agents seized almost 20 tons of cocaine--worth up to $6 billion on the street--at a San Fernando Valley warehouse, officials said Friday. The Drug Enforcement Administration said the seizure represents about 5% of the worlds annual production of the drug--more cocaine than growers in Peru, the worlds largest supplier, can produce in a month.
